Anyone who’s tried to translate a Spanish menu, email, or legal document knows the frustration of clunky, literal translations. The good news is that free online tools have become remarkably good — good enough for everyday use, if you know which one to pick.

Google Translate languages: 100+ ·
DeepL supported languages: 31 ·
SpanishDict word/phrase count: 1 million+ ·
Daily translation volume (Google): over 100 billion characters

Quick snapshot

1Confirmed facts
2What’s unclear
3Timeline signal
  • Google Translate accuracy varies by language from 55% to 94% (Lokalise)
4What’s next

Three key data points show how these translation tools stack up: Google Translate’s broad language support, DeepL’s narrower but high-accuracy focus, and SpanishDict’s dictionary depth.

Metric Google Translate DeepL
Supported languages 100+ (Language IO) 31 (Language IO)
Free plan limit Unlimited free 500,000 characters/month (DeepL)
Document upload PDF, DOCX, images (Google Support) PDF, DOCX, PPTX (max 10 MB) (DeepL)
Real-time conversation Tap-to-speak mode (Google Support) Voice input (app) (DeepL)
Accuracy (Spanish→English) ~90%+ for general text (Lokalise) Often more natural phrasing (Phrase)
Privacy Translation history stored by default (Google Support) Pro option: no data retention (University of Wisconsin Law Library)

“DeepL is often preferred for naturalness and idiomatic expression” — University of Wisconsin Law Library, noting its edge over Google Translate in European language pairs.

How can I translate Spanish to English for free?

Using Google Translate for free

Google Translate is the most accessible free option. It supports over 100 languages and offers text, voice, and image translation through its web and mobile interfaces. Users can enter up to 5,000 characters at a time without logging in (Google Translate). A 2025 comparison noted it handles over 100 billion characters per day globally (Language IO).

Free alternatives like DeepL and SpanishDict

DeepL offers a free tier limited to 500,000 characters per month but praised for natural-sounding translations, especially for European languages including Spanish (Phrase). SpanishDict provides free word and phrase translations along with a dictionary of over 1 million entries, ideal for learners who need context and conjugation help (SpanishDict).

Free mobile apps

Both Google Translate and DeepL have free mobile apps for iOS and Android. The Google Translate app includes a conversation mode that lets two speakers talk and see translations in real time (Google Support). DeepL’s app offers voice input and allows translation of text from photos using the device camera.

Bottom line: For casual users, Google Translate’s unlimited free access and broad language coverage make it the best starting point. Students and writers seeking idiomatic accuracy should try DeepL’s free tier. SpanishDict is the top choice for quick word lookups.

The pattern: Google Translate offers the broadest free access, while DeepL and SpanishDict fill specific niches for quality and learning.

Which is the most accurate Spanish to English translator?

DeepL vs Google Translate accuracy

DeepL is repeatedly praised for producing more natural, idiomatic translations for European language pairs, including Spanish (Taia). A law-library guide from the University of Wisconsin says DeepL “is often preferred for naturalness and idiomatic expression” while Google Translate offers more versatility in language coverage. A cited study found Google Translate accurately conveyed the meaning of 330 out of 400 instructions (82.5%), but accuracy varies by language from 55% to 94% (Lokalise). For Spanish→English, the Lokalise review says Google Translate’s accuracy is generally over 90%.

SpanishDict for contextual translations

SpanishDict excels at providing contextual definitions and example sentences, helping users choose the right word for a given situation. Its dictionary includes conjugation tables and usage notes that machine translation engines often miss. However, it is best for word and phrase lookups, not full-text document translation.

Accuracy for formal vs informal texts

For formal documents like business contracts or academic papers, DeepL’s attention to nuance and idiomatic flow often delivers better results. Google Translate, while improving with neural networks, can still produce literal constructions that lose tone. A 2026 comparison noted DeepL ranked highest in 65% of language pairs tested in Intento benchmarks (Language IO).

“DeepL generally produces more natural-sounding translations for European language pairs, including Spanish, Italian, French, and German” — Phrase, citing user studies and benchmark comparisons.

The trade-off

Google Translate wins on breadth and cost; DeepL wins on finesse in European languages. Anyone using Spanish for professional writing should test both — but DeepL will likely need fewer edits for tone.

What this means: For casual use, Google Translate’s accuracy is sufficient; for polished writing, DeepL requires fewer revisions.

How do I translate a Spanish PDF, image, or document to English?

Translating PDFs with Google Translate

Google Translate supports uploading documents in PDF and other formats directly on its website. Users can drag and drop a file, and the system preserves the structure while translating the text. This works best for text-based PDFs without complex tables or scanned images.

Using DeepL for document translation

DeepL also handles file uploads for PDF, DOCX, and PPTX files. The free tier limits file size and volume, but the translation maintains formatting. The University of Wisconsin Law Library guide notes that DeepL can offer full document translation while preserving original formatting, though some features require a premium account.

OCR for images in translation apps

Mobile apps use optical character recognition (OCR) to extract text from photos. Google Translate’s camera mode lets you point your phone at text and see an overlaid translation in real time. DeepL’s app includes a similar photo translation feature. Both work well on clear printed text; handwriting remains a challenge.

The catch

Free versions of both Google Translate and DeepL retain translation history on their servers. For sensitive business documents, DeepL Pro’s no-data-retention policy is a significant privacy advantage (University of Wisconsin Law Library).

The implication: Free document translation comes with privacy trade-offs that professionals should consider carefully before uploading sensitive files.

Can I translate Spanish to English in real time for conversations?

Real-time conversation mode in Google Translate

Google Translate’s conversation mode lets two speakers tap a microphone and see translations appear on screen in near-real time. The app automatically detects which language is being spoken based on the device orientation or manual selection. A 2025 review notes this feature works well in quiet environments.

Using live translation apps

Beyond Google Translate, apps like iTranslate and Microsoft Translator offer similar real-time voice features. DeepL’s mobile app supports voice input but does not have a dedicated two-person conversation mode. For casual face-to-face conversations, Google Translate’s conversation mode is the most mature free option.

Voice translation features

Accuracy for voice translation declines in noisy environments or with strong accents. The Lokalise review’s accuracy findings (55%–94% depending on language) apply to text input; voice adds another layer of variability. Still, for simple tourist interactions or quick clarifications, these tools are effective.

What to watch

When using voice translation in a business meeting or medical setting, test the tool beforehand in the same environment. Background noise is the single biggest accuracy killer.

The implication: Real-time translation works best in controlled environments; expect lower accuracy in noisy or informal settings.

What is the best app for translating Spanish to English?

Top-rated translation apps on iOS and Android

Google Translate consistently ranks as the most installed translation app globally, with a 4.6-star rating across app stores. DeepL’s app has gained popularity for its high-quality translations in supported languages. SpanishDict’s app is a niche favorite for Spanish learners, combining translation with dictionary and conjugation tools.

Google Translate app features

The Google Translate app includes text, voice, camera, conversation, and handwriting input. It works offline for 59 languages. For Spanish→English, offline quality is lower but functional for basic phrases.

Specialized apps: iTranslate and Microsoft Translator

iTranslate offers a premium voice mode with real-time translation in over 100 languages. Microsoft Translator integrates with Office apps and supports multi-person conversations. Neither has the same Spanish-specific depth as SpanishDict or the broad user base of Google Translate.

Bottom line: For most users, Google Translate’s free app is the best all-around choice. DeepL’s app is the better pick when translation quality matters most. SpanishDict learners should install it alongside a general translator for quick lookups.

The pattern: No single app dominates all scenarios — the best choice depends on whether you prioritize breadth, accuracy, or learning support.

Three popular tools cover very different needs: one simple pattern emerges.

Feature Google Translate DeepL SpanishDict
Best for Broad use, real-time conversation, document upload Accurate, idiomatic European language translation Word lookup, conjugation, learning
Free limits Unlimited 500,000 char/month Unlimited for words/phrases
Offline support Yes (59 languages) No (online only) No
Privacy Translation history saved Pro: no data retention History optional

The implication: no single tool dominates every scenario. For quick, free, on-the-go translation, Google Translate is the default. For polished written Spanish→English, DeepL is the editor’s pick. SpanishDict fills the niche for learners.

Upsides

  • All three tools are free to start using
  • Google Translate covers 100+ languages for broad utility
  • DeepL offers high-quality, natural sounding translations for Spanish
  • Mobile apps make translation accessible anytime

Downsides

  • Machine translation still struggles with idioms and cultural nuance
  • Free versions retain translation history, raising privacy concerns
  • Offline quality is significantly lower than online
  • Document formatting may be lost during translation

Step-by-step: Translate a Spanish document to English

  1. Choose your tool based on the document type
    For text-based PDFs, use Google Translate’s document upload or DeepL’s file upload. For images, use the camera mode in either app.
  2. Upload the file or scan the text
    On the web, drag and drop your file onto the translator interface. In-app, use the camera icon to capture text from a screen or paper.
  3. Review and edit the output
    Machine translations are a first draft. Read through the result for tone and accuracy, especially for legal or business documents. Use DeepL’s glossary feature to enforce specific terminology (University of Wisconsin Law Library).
  4. Check privacy for sensitive content
    If the document contains personal or confidential data, consider DeepL Pro for its no-data-retention policy or use a local dictionary tool offline.
Privacy alert

Never upload sensitive legal, medical, or financial documents to free translation services without checking the privacy policy. Both Google and DeepL’s free plans retain processed text for product improvement.

The implication: Following these steps systematically helps avoid common pitfalls in document translation, particularly around privacy and accuracy.

Confirmed facts and what remains unclear

Confirmed facts

  • Google Translate is free and supports 100+ languages (Language IO)
  • DeepL offers higher accuracy for European language pairs like Spanish (University of Wisconsin Law Library)
  • SpanishDict includes a dictionary with over 1 million entries (SpanishDict)

What’s unclear

  • Which tool performs best for business documents with complex formatting or tables?
  • How will future AI developments affect translation accuracy for idiomatic Spanish?
  • Can machine translation ever capture regional dialects and subtle cultural references reliably?
  • Google Translate processes over 100 billion characters daily — how this volume affects individual translation quality remains underdocumented (Language IO).

For Spanish speakers and learners, the takeaway is straightforward: choose Google Translate for everyday needs, DeepL for quality-critical writing, and SpanishDict for vocabulary building. The tool you pick should match the complexity of your text and the level of accuracy you require.

For a direct comparison of Google, DeepL, and SpanishDict, check out our guide on three free tools for Spanish to English.

Frequently asked questions

Is Spanish to English translation free?

Yes, all three tools covered in this article offer free tiers. Google Translate is entirely free with no character limits. DeepL free plan allows up to 500,000 characters per month. SpanishDict is free for word and phrase translations.

How accurate is machine translation for Spanish to English?

Accuracy varies widely. For Spanish→English, Google Translate scores above 90% in general texts, but can miss idioms. DeepL delivers more natural phrasing for European Spanish. Accuracy for handwritten or scanned text is lower.

Can I translate an entire Spanish website to English?

Yes. Google Translate can translate entire web pages automatically when you enter the URL into the translate bar. However, this may not preserve complex layouts.

Do I need to install an app to translate?

No. All three tools work in a web browser without installation. Apps are available for convenient mobile use.

What is the fastest way to translate Spanish to English?

For short text, paste into Google Translate or DeepL web interface. For spoken word, Google Translate’s conversation mode gives near-real-time results.

Are there offline translation options?

Google Translate supports offline translation for 59 languages, including Spanish, but with lower quality. DeepL and SpanishDict require an internet connection for full functionality.

How do I translate Spanish handwriting to English?

Google Translate’s camera mode can handle clear printed handwriting on simple backgrounds, but it struggles with cursive or faint text. Best to type the text if possible.